The search field is very powerful and you can search “Find Router” using a large variety of keywords or strings.

Note: Search is done in the data set loaded into the browser. This makes it very fast but the browser content must be updated. To search through resent content please refresh your browser before search. (Press F5 to reload content.)

All static data points are searchable. For example:

Name of router - ICCID of SIM card - Group name - Cellular model (ie: “ME909u-521”) - Router Model (ie: “WR44”) - software version (ie: “Ver5.2.17.12”)

If you want to find all routers from a specific operator you can search for first 7 digits in the ICCID.

You can then select the routers by checking the check box - individually or all. If you want to do a job on a selection of routers you can do a search, select the routers and do another search to unselect routers you want to exclude. After all routers have been selected you can click the “Selected” tab and do the task you want.

It is also possible to tag the routers with a label and use this for searching.
